Check the Idle Speed Control Actuator. It's located under the air intake tube right near the intake manifold connection. If it's not reading signals correctly it will cause erratic idling. I'm thinking that when you decelerate the ISCA is allowing the throttle linkage to retract too much causing a stall. I have personal experience replace one on my previously owned '94 Eldorado.
